Matlab与C/C++混合编程中的唯一信息获取

需积分: 43 184 下载量 100 浏览量 更新于2024-08-10 收藏 2.44MB PDF 举报
"唯一信息的取得功能-matlab与c_c++混合编程 张亮 等编 2008年" 这篇文档介绍了在编程环境中如何实现唯一信息的获取,特别是在分布式系统中,通过MATLAB与C/C++的混合编程。核心概念是`Identifier`对象,它能够自动生成唯一的ID,确保在所有Application Runtime中保持唯一性。这个功能基于Server Manager的管理信息,用于控制每个Application Runtime在系统内的唯一标识。 在MATLAB和C/C++混合编程中,`Identifier`对象提供了API,使得开发者可以调用`get()`静态方法来生成一个全局唯一的ID字符串。这在多进程或分布式系统中尤其重要,因为需要确保每个进程或节点都有一个独特的身份,以便于跟踪、管理和通信。 在提及的`intra-mart`平台中,我们看到这是一份关于WebPlatform/AppFramework Ver.7.1的脚本开发模式编程指南。该指南可能涉及多个版本的更新,例如第三版新增了对快捷方式访问功能的说明,并对其他部分进行了修订。`intra-mart`似乎是一个企业级的Web应用框架,提供了多种功能,包括脚本开发、数据共享、数据库操作以及Java组件的使用等。 在脚本开发模式中,开发者可以创建PresentationPages(HTML)和FunctionContainers(JavaScript)来构建用户界面和处理逻辑。例如,教程引导开发者如何创建基本页面、实现跨页面数据共享、从数据库获取并显示数据,以及执行数据的登记、更新和删除操作。此外,`im-BizAPI`组件群提供了通用的界面模块,帮助开发者更高效地设计和实现业务逻辑。 这篇文档涵盖了在MATLAB和C/C++混合环境中获取唯一标识的技术,以及`intra-mart`平台上脚本开发的基本流程和组件使用,这对于理解分布式系统中的身份管理和Web应用开发有着重要的指导价值。